Duties and Responsibilities:
Perform donor identification, registration, and screening; to determine donor suitability according to cGMPs, DCOPs, CFR, PPTA standards, customer specifications and Company policies.
Must be able to draw vein and finger stick samples as required.
Maintain smooth and efficient flow of donors through registration and screening.
Must be competent in assessing pre-donation unsuitability signals, performing vital signs, HCT/TP testing, donor deferral and donor reaction management.
Coordinate with physician/physician substitutes for physicals, assessments, document review, SPE approval, NAT testing protocols, immunizations, etc.
Perform calibration and cleaning of equipment as required by pre-determined schedules and in accordance with DCOP’s.
Perform donor identification and review of records according to SOP’s.
Perform Haemonetics Autopheresis setup and programming with understanding of alarm signals during operation, shut down, and in the event of power failure.
Maintain equipment calibration, standardization, and cleaning schedules according to SOP’s.
Ensure that the donor floor is properly stocked with supplies and soft goods.
